Financial Regulation Changes

Regulation

Financial regulation changes impacting cryptocurrency, options trading, and derivatives markets necessitate a recalibration of risk management frameworks, particularly concerning systemic risk assessment and counterparty credit exposure. These adjustments often stem from evolving interpretations of existing securities laws applied to novel asset classes, creating uncertainty for market participants and influencing trading strategies. Regulatory scrutiny increasingly focuses on decentralized finance (DeFi) protocols, aiming to establish clear jurisdictional boundaries and enforce compliance with anti-money laundering (AML) and know-your-customer (KYC) requirements. The implementation of comprehensive regulatory frameworks is expected to increase institutional participation, potentially enhancing market liquidity and price discovery.
